Part Time Operations Coordinator - Scottsdale
Part Time Operations Coordinator
Cartier
Reports to: Boutique Director
Job Mission
The Operations Coordinator contributes to the overall commercial success of the boutique by upholding Maison compliance and achieving operational excellence. In a highly dynamic and collaborative environment, the Operations Coordinator is responsible for managing all aspects of the dayto-day processes, including key administrative support for transactional activities, financial compliance, logistics, inventory control, and effectively supports the implementation of policies and procedures.
Key Responsibilities
Operational excellence / compliance
• Ensure proper understanding and execution of all Maison policies and procedures within the boutique; champion and influence compliance among the broader team
• Coordinate efficient opening and closing procedures
• Ensure proper movement of product in/out of boutique including, but not limited to shipments, transfers, consignments, and movement throughout the boutique while maintaining quality control and preventing stock losses
• Consistently demonstrate excellent care and proper product handling, and follow appropriate packing, shipping, and receiving procedures particularly for high value creations
• Monitor financial aspects of boutique sales; ensure daily transactions and proper paperwork are submitted to respective corporate teams timely and accurately
• Support other transactional flows (ecommerce, etc.) to ensure efficient business operations and seamless client experience Coordinate inventory control processes (e.g., daily/weekly/monthly counts and stock movements to ensure a successful annual inventory
• Uphold Cartier standards within the boutique environment, including but not limited to maintenance, third party vendors, tools
and technology, equipment, etc.
• Partner with client-facing teams to manage the boutique supply inventory including replenishment needs for sales and hospitality areas, as well as back of house; manage the order process andsupport Lean/5S strategies for optimal storage organization
• Assist with care service responsibilities as needed (e.g., the client repair flow, execution of reports, and monthly inventory/reconciliation)
• Support overall success of boutique audits; partner with management to implement and execute action plans
• Participate in daily set up and break down of boutique for opening/closing as needed
• Exhibit strong communication and problem-solving skills by partnering effectively with boutique management and peers
• Assist with special projects as needed
• Consistently reach and aim to exceed all KPIs
